The most recent issue of Lavender Magazine did an article about how the
fundementalist christian group, Urban Ventures has gotten government
support and funding.

http://www.lavendermagazine.com/181/181_news_20.html  

The article includes quotes from Annie Young posted on the Minneapolis
Issues list.  

The article pointed out that Peter McLauglin's site includes the following:  

http://www.co.hennepin.mn.us/countyboard/district4/d4events.htm

Homefield Soccer
 
Art Erickson, President of Urban Ventures, joins Peter McLaughlin at the
construction site of Homefield soccer fields which will serve over 300
urban youth this summer. The county loaned Urban Ventures $500,000 to start
construction. The loan was paid back on time.

=======================================
I'd like to hear more about the terms of this loan.  What type of interest
rate did Urban Ventures get on this loan.
